Hello,

We have a Konica Minolta C454e, a blue spot appears on appr. every onehundred's print. I have replaced the blue drum unit, cleaned the belt and the DV unit.
Do you have any other suggestions, what else can I do?

Post total counter and consumables life. I suspect your fault is following dreaded cyan developer depletion discussed here numerous times.

blackcat4866
10-14-2021, 12:42 AM
Those look to me like color registration patches. I think if you look at the primary transfer belt you'll probably see a poor belt cleaning issue. If yes, check the primary transfer belt cleaner unit. It's probably backed up. Also check the primary transfer spout, waste bottle, and clean the primary transfer alienation sensor. It's on the back wall of the machine behind the belt, and monitors the movement of the color primary transfer rollers. Photo? Yes:
